Abstract: This study investigates the relationship between renewable energy consumption, economic growth and environmental factors in Romania over the period 1990–2022. Using annual data and a time-series econometric framework, the analysis examines the long-run and short-run dynamics between gross domestic product (GDP), renewable energy consumption, carbon dioxide (CO₂) emissions, energy use, gross capital formation and trade openness. The Autoregressive Distributed Lag model approach is employed to explore cointegration relationships among the variables. The empirical results reveal the existence of a long-run equilibrium relationship between economic growth and the selected explanatory variables. Renewable energy consumption is found to have a positive but statistically insignificant impact on economic growth, suggesting that its contribution remains limited in the Romanian context. At the same time, CO₂ emissions and energy use are positively associated with economic growth, indicating that Romania’s economic expansion is still partially dependent on conventional energy sources. Gross capital formation plays a significant role, particularly in the short run. The short-run dynamics confirm the adjustment towards long-run equilibrium, while causality analysis highlights the directional relationships between the variables. Overall, the findings emphasize the need to strengthen renewable energy policies to support sustainable economic growth.
